Step 1 Understand Historical Context. Step 2 Identify Key Drivers. Step 3 Forecast Income Statement and Cash Flows. Step 4 Project Future Balances. Step 5 Incorporate Strategic Initiatives. Step 6 Review and Adjust. Step 7 Finalize and Communicate.
To make a projected balance sheet: Gather financial data and forecasts. Estimate revenue, expenses, assets, and liabilities. Calculate equity. Organize data into the balance sheet format. Review and adjust for accuracy. Document assumptions and methodologies.
How to Prepare a Cash Flow Statement Step 1: Remember the Interconnectivity Between PL and Balance Sheet. Step 2: The Cash Account Can Be Expressed as a Sum and Subtraction of All Other Accounts. Step 3: Break Down and Rearrange the Accounts. Step 4: Convert the Rearranged Balance Sheet Into a Cash Flow Statement.
Follow these seven steps. Start With Your Most Recent Balance Sheet. Determine Which Accounts Should Start From Net Zero. Forecast Net Working Capital Accounts. Pull In Data From Your Cash Flow Projection. Consider The Impact Of New Strategic Initiatives. Account For Upcoming Funding Rounds. Build Upside/Downside Scenarios.
To create an income statement of your own, follow these steps: Choose the correct income statement type. Create a heading. Generate a trial balance report. Calculate revenue. Determine the cost of goods sold (COGS) Calculate gross margin. Calculate operating expenses and income. Calculate income tax and net income.

To create a projected income statement, its important to take into account revenues, cost of goods sold, gross profit, and operating expenses. Using the equation gross profit - operating expenses = net income, the projected income can be estimated. Revenues are defined as the sales to customers.
How to forecast your cash flow Forecast your income or sales. First, decide on a period that you want to forecast. Estimate cash inflows. Estimate cash outflows and expenses. Compile the estimates into your cash flow forecast. Review your estimated cash flows against the actual.
If you need to create a projected balance sheet for your company, here are some steps to follow to do so: Create a format for the projected balance sheet. Gather past financial statements. Review your past and ongoing assets and liabilities. Project your fixed assets. Estimate the companys debt. Forecast your equity.
